Progress report

Posted in Running,iPhone App by Alex on December 23, 2008

Last Saturday morning I went out for my first c25k run. I chose against the treadmill in the basement and opted for an outdoor run. Well I came to regret that decision five minutes into the workout. I had warm clothes and a hat on, but my hands were freezing. Next time I will wear gloves.

Following the workout's 1 minute running 1.5 minutes walking for the first day turned out to be a chalenge. I kind of expected that, I'm im a terible shape. Couple of repetitions down the road I started having my longest minutes yet. Those 60 seconds seemed never ending and 90 seconds of walking were so short.

The mechanics of switching between running and walking proved difficult as well. I had to constanly look at my watch and keep reseting the stopwatch function. But that was encouranging for my C25K iPhone effort. I can now say they there's definetely a need for an iPhone/iPod Touch application to help with the program.

So how's the app progressing? It's going very well actually. I'll almost done with major development. But more about that next time. I'll even include some screen shots.

I'm been trying to get fit for a few years now. All my previous attempts have failed. I bought a treadmill and brought it in the bedroom, but pretty soon the treadmill found its way to the basement. I joined a fitness club thinking that having somewhere else to go to exercise would make me stick with it, but that lasted only for a couple of months. So, after a few failed attempts, I kind of gave up for awhile. It was always at the back of my mind, I just kept pushing it back and making excuses.

A few months ago, my wife mentioned that one of her friends started following a running program she found online which helped her get active and stick with it. I thought that was great idea, and started Googling around for such a program. The first one to come up was Counch-to-5K by Josh Clark. After reading it and poking around the Internet about it I though it was just what I needed to get me started.

So, here we are, I'm starting exercising again. So, what will be different this time around?

First, I'll be following a program, so having something to stick to should help. Second, I started this blog. It will be yet another commitment to keep me going. I'll be posting after every workout session. Third, I'm working on a iPhone app that will make it easier for aspiring runners to follow the C25K program. I'll be testing that app during my workouts.
